Prague Public Transport
Prague Metro map , Prague Metro information, Prague Metro: Prague Tram: TRAMS The Prague tram network covers all areas of the city centre, and extends some distance into the suburbs, Daytime trams operate 04:30-24:00, The most popular trams run every 4 minutes, Other trams run every 8-10 minutes during the week, every 8-15 minutes at weekends, Night trams operate 24:00-04:30 and run every 30

Prague Tram Streetcar Transport: Map, Tickets, Lines
The Prague Public Transit Co, Inc,, completely owned by the city, is the operator of the tram network, All tramway passenger coaches are visibly marked with the number of the line, and on the sides you can also find info tables with the most important stations on the route, Older coaches have plastic or metal information boards, while the more modern ones are equipped with electronic displays

Prague Metro Subway
The Prague subway is fast, efficient, clean and easy to use, Its three lines consist of about 62 km of tracks running mostly underground, and 61 stations, New stations continue to be added, The Prague metro is only about 45 years old it was first opened in 1974 and is mostly Russian-built, Metro Lines,
Prague Metro
The Prague Metro Czech: Pražské metro is the rapid transit network of Prague, Czech Republic,Founded in 1974, the Prague Metro now comprises three lines A, B and C, serving 61 stations predominantly with island platforms, and consists of a transit network 65,2 kilometres 40,5 mi long, Prague Metro system served 589,2 million passengers in 2012 about 1,6 million daily, making it the
